170304-N-CF980-001 PACIFIC OCEAN (March 4, 2017) An AIM-9M Sidewinder launches from an F/A-18E Super Hornet assigned to the "Eagles" of Strike Fighter Squadron (VFA)115 during a missile shoot exercise in the Point Mugu Sea Range. VFA-115 is operating from Naval Air Station Fallon, Nevada, to complete the Strike Fighter Advanced Readiness Program. (U.S. Navy photo by Lt. Chris Pagenkopf/Released)...
